How they compare
Peru currently reports 51.17 1000 ha against 45.04 1000 ha in Switzerland, a difference of 6.13 1000 ha.
That makes Peru's figure about 1.1 times Switzerland's.
The two have swapped places 1 time across 24 shared years of data; in 2001 it was Switzerland ahead.
Peru ranks 20th and Switzerland ranks 21st of 240 countries.
Across the 3 decades both report, Peru averaged higher in 2 and Switzerland in 1.
Head to head by decade
| Decade | Peru | Switzerland | Difference | Ahead |
|---|---|---|---|---|
| 2000s | 56.4 1000 ha | 66.96 1000 ha | 10.56 1000 ha | Switzerland |
| 2010s | 64.83 1000 ha | 54.08 1000 ha | 10.75 1000 ha | Peru |
| 2020s | 56.73 1000 ha | 48.18 1000 ha | 8.56 1000 ha | Peru |
Averages of every year both report within each decade.

About this data
The FAOSTAT domain on Land Cover data under the Agri-Environmental Indicators section contains land cover information organized by the land cover classes of the international standard system for Environmental and Economic Accounting Central Framework (SEEA CF). The land cover information is compiled from publicly available Global Land Cover (GLC) maps: a) MODIS land cover types based on the Land Cover Classification System, LCCS; b) The European Spatial Agency (ESA) Climate Change Initiative (CCI) annual land cover maps produced by the Université catholique de Louvain (UCL)-Geomatics and now under the European Copernicus Program; c) The annual land cover maps which were produced under the European Copernicus Global Land Service (CGLS) (CGLS land cover, containing discrete land cover categorization), with spatial resolution 100m; and d) the WorldCover maps of the European Space Agency, produced at 10m resolution.
